package auth_test
import (
"bytes"
"encoding/json"
"net/http"
"net/http/httptest"
"strings"
"testing"
"time"
"golang.org/x/crypto/bcrypt"
"github.com/cu-points/backend/internal/auth"
)
func newTestHandler(repo auth.UserRepository) *auth.Handler {
jwtMgr := auth.NewJWTManager(
"test-secret-minimum-32-characters-long",
15*time.Minute,
168*time.Hour,
)
svc := auth.NewService(repo, jwtMgr)
return auth.NewHandler(svc)
}
// ─── Login ───────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
func TestHandler_Login_Success(t *testing.T) {
hash, _ := bcrypt.GenerateFromPassword([]byte("pass123"), bcrypt.MinCost)
repo := &mockRepo{
user: &auth.UserRecord{
ID: "u-1",
Email: "a@cu.ru",
PasswordHash: string(hash),
Role: "student",
},
}
h := newTestHandler(repo)
body, _ := json.Marshal(map[string]string{"email": "a@cu.ru", "password": "pass123"})
req := httptest.NewRequest(http.MethodPost, "/api/v1/auth/login", bytes.NewReader(body))
req.Header.Set("Content-Type", "application/json")
w := httptest.NewRecorder()
h.Login(w, req)
if w.Code != http.StatusOK {
t.Fatalf("expected 200, got %d: %s", w.Code, w.Body.String())
}
var resp struct {
Data struct {
AccessToken string `json:"access_token"`
RefreshToken string `json:"refresh_token"`
} `json:"data"`
}
if err := json.NewDecoder(w.Body).Decode(&resp);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("decode: %v", err)
}
if resp.Data.AccessToken == "" || resp.Data.RefreshToken == "" {
t.Error("expected both tokens to be non-empty")
}
}
func TestHandler_Login_InvalidJSON(t *testing.T) {
h := newTestHandler(&mockRepo{})
req := httptest.NewRequest(http.MethodPost, "/api/v1/auth/login",
strings.NewReader("{bad json"))
w := httptest.NewRecorder()
h.Login(w, req)
if w.Code != http.StatusBadRequest {
t.Fatalf("expected 400, got %d", w.Code)
}
}
func TestHandler_Login_MissingFields(t *testing.T) {
h := newTestHandler(&mockRepo{})
body, _ := json.Marshal(map[string]string{"email": "", "password": ""})
req := httptest.NewRequest(http.MethodPost, "/api/v1/auth/login", bytes.NewReader(body))
req.Header.Set("Content-Type", "application/json")
w := httptest.NewRecorder()
h.Login(w, req)
if w.Code != http.StatusBadRequest {
t.Fatalf("expected 400, got %d", w.Code)
}
}
func TestHandler_Login_WrongPassword(t *testing.T) {
hash, _ := bcrypt.GenerateFromPassword([]byte("correct"), bcrypt.MinCost)
repo := &mockRepo{
user: &auth.UserRecord{
ID: "u-1",
Email: "a@cu.ru",
PasswordHash: string(hash),
Role: "student",
},
}
h := newTestHandler(repo)
body, _ := json.Marshal(map[string]string{"email": "a@cu.ru", "password": "wrong"})
req := httptest.NewRequest(http.MethodPost, "/api/v1/auth/login", bytes.NewReader(body))
req.Header.Set("Content-Type", "application/json")
w := httptest.NewRecorder()
h.Login(w, req)
if w.Code != http.StatusUnauthorized {
t.Fatalf("expected 401, got %d", w.Code)
}
}
